A leading dental practice in Aberdeen is seeking an Associate Dentist to join their team on a permanent basis. The role offers flexible work of 4-5 days per week with a diverse patient list, including opportunities to focus on implant dentistry.
Candidates should have at least two years of postgraduate experience, GDC registration, and an NHS List Number. This is a chance to be part of a supportive practice with experienced staff and advanced tools, providing competitive earnings of up to £140,000 annually.
